If there was an award for the most unexpected collab ever, Janet Jackson’s (potential) new single Heart, Beat, Love would be up for a nomination. At first glance we have a random crew of musicians on Heart, Beat, Love, but the combination is nothing less than a certified pop hit. First and foremost is the legendary Janet Jackson, the ringleader of this circus-like song whose smooth and sexy vocals are erotically draped over a Darkchild production that’s sure to be a dance club favorite. With a foundation like that you know they had to get fiery Latino emcee Pitbull, who delivers yet another exciting performance. Add in Machel Montano and Booth favorites Rock City (who appear briefly but are effective in keeping the song lively) and you can see that Janet did her research on which newcomers are making the clubs rock.
